We stayed at Opoa beach hotel for a week and had a lovely time! The hotel is charming, quaint and brilliantly located on the lagoon.

Arnould the hotel owner was extremely helpful and accommodating with a room change and also taking into account that I was a vegetarian + did not eat some of the meals at the hotel and gave me a discount for the half board. I really appreciated the service.

Fantastic marine life and the island is green and lush! Most specifically the site of Taptapu’atea is mesmerising. Can’t recommend visiting Opoa beach hotel and Raiatea enough!

        We stayed 4 days at this beautiful beach hotel. Everything about it exceeded our expectations from arrival to departure. We were greeted with lays and a cold tea drink followed by a gorgeous cottage overlooking the beach including a hammock on the porch and flowers from the garden on our bed. A healthy French Breakfast and choice of dinner plates were included in the price of the cottage. The amenities were outstanding including the bar and pool. They even had a band with Tahitian dancers one night. They staff was professional and very friendly. Arnold also made arrangements for excursions for us. I would definitely recommend this hotel to anyone wanting to experience Tahiti at its best.

        This beautiful little hotel exceeded all my expectations. From my reservation to departure everything was wonderful. The bungalows are charming, spotlessly clean, mattresses new, linen fresh. The beach bungalows each with spectacular views of the motu and island of Huahine.
        Food was top class presented with style and finesse. Nice wine selection lots of choice
        Arnaud and his partner perfect hosts and having just taken over the hotel working on creating perfection.
        Thank you to all the staff for your welcome and kindness - you are all wonderful ambassadors of your exceptionally beautiful island home Raiatea
        Highly recommended
        Tip Hire a car from arrival and spend at least 3 days on this magnificent island

        Local and lovely. This place is quite unique. It’s very remote but that adds to the attraction. The lady who runs the place has limited English (but still better than my very limited French!) but she is very kind and helpful and booked us tours and helped with food choices, even handwriting the menu in English for us. The food is excellent and good value. The villas are authentic and thoughtful. Thoroughly recommend

        Room tip: Villas at the front are cooler and the best. We had number 6 at the back, and had to use the air conditioner. Still nice though.
